Would've been a four star as I found the book fairly engaging, but the end annoyed me. Claire Elliot is the main character, we see most of the book through her eyes, she is the key figure pushing for answers. And yet at the end of book (minor spoilers about how the end is handled rather than story specifics)
Spoilera man is given the answers and thinking about them, rather than her? She will just presumably find out the whole answers to the mystery at some other point when she's had a little rest? Indeed even the final paragraphs are given to the man in question!
It felt rather rushed, which was a shame as it was quite enjoyable if not super exceptional up to that point.
